Transponder Keys

Transponder keys are utilized by the majority of modern cars. This adds a layer of security that makes it more difficult for thieves to steal cars. They are also difficult to duplicate since they contain a microchip that emits a radio signal on a low level that authenticates the keys. This signal only activates when the key is within a certain distance from the car. Your car will not start in the event that the signal isn't detected. This feature is a great way to prevent hotwiring.

To create a duplicate transponder key, locksmiths for automotive use will need to program the microchip on the new key to match the original. This procedure requires a special tool that communicates with the car in order to verify the chip's unique serial number is stored in the database. After the key has been programmed, you are able to use it to unlock doors and switch on the ignition. Certain locksmiths will program the key on site while others require the transponder code of the vehicle's computer.

Some automobile brands, like Chevy and Ford, do not require a special tool to program their keys. Instead, they can be programmed using an on-board programming process (OBP). If you own the OBP key and a working key fob that is working, you may be interested in bringing it in for a repair prior to buying a new one from an authorized dealer.

If you're not able to repair your key fob an auto locksmith can usually provide replacement keys at a lower price. However, it's important keep in mind that transponder keys tend to be more expensive than traditional bladed keys because they contain an additional piece of technology.

Smart Keys

A smart key is a key for cars equipped with a specific microchip that lets drivers unlock their vehicles and start them without inserting the physical key. These keys are usually designed like plastic cards and work with wireless technology. The rolling codes guarantee that the key's code each key matches the code on the emergency car key locksmith. This makes it more difficult for thieves to duplicate the signal and enter your vehicle.

Smart keys are now available on a wide range of modern automobiles, and are an incredible convenience. The main drawback is that replacing the keys in the event that they become lost or damaged can be quite expensive. Finding a replacement at the dealership could cost as much as $220 and isn't always easy to accomplish in a timely manner. In this instance, it's often quicker and easier to call an experienced locksmith.

Automotive locksmiths can program the smart key or FOB faster than dealerships. They can accomplish this by connecting a computer to software designed specifically for key programming in cars, and then plugging it into the OBD port that is located under your dashboard. This allows the technician to enter the programming mode, and then alter the data in order for your new key to match the code on the vehicle's computer.

Besides being more practical than traditional keys In addition, smart keys are also safer for drivers and passengers. Smart keys can be erased so that they no longer work and are not able to open or start your vehicle. A traditional key that's stolen is easily copied by a criminal, and you may end up with a second car.
